7.11 CONTROL OPERATIONS.
1. Time setting.
Set date and time of the relay and verify the proper operation.
To set date and time use the
SET
DATE
/
TIME
menu in the ACTions menu. To enter into this menu press
ACT
key
from the main display showing
DFF - GENERAL ELECTRIC
.
2. Communications Trigger.
Apply an AC voltage to any phase and trigger the oscillography capture using the
ACT
–
COMM
TRIGGER
command. Retrieve the oscillography register using
GE_LOCAL
or
DFFPC
software and display the record using
GE_OSC
software package. Verify that the captured waveform fits with the applied voltage signal.
7.12 INHIBIT VOLTAGE CHECK.
NOTE: Tests must be done with phase B.
NOMINAL VOLTAGE setting is phase-to-phase voltage.
Injected voltages are phase-to-ground.
•
Set the relay
NOMINAL FREQUENCY
to nominal frequency (50 or 60 Hz).
•
Set one frequency unit as absolute threshold and set the operating value to 110% of nominal frequency.
•
Set nominal voltage to 90 Vac (
NOMINAL VOLTAGE
setting is phase-to-phase voltage).
•
Set inhibition voltage to 40 % (0.4x90V = 36Vph-ph = 20.8Vph-gnd).
•
Provide a 10Vac voltage signal on phase B terminals, at nominal frequency.
•
Check that the unit trips with 22 Vac and does not trip with 19 Vac
•
Set inhibition voltage to 110 % (1.1x90V = 99Vph-ph = 57Vph-gnd).
•
Check that the unit trips with 61 Vac and does not trip with 54 Vac.
•
Set nominal voltage to 220 Vac.
•
Set inhibition voltage to 40 % (0.4x220V = 88Vph-ph = 50.8Vph-gnd).
•
Check that the unit trips with 54 Vac and does not trip with 48 Vac.
•
Set inhibition voltage to 110 % (1.1x220V = 242Vph-ph = 139.7Vph-gnd).
•
Check that the unit trips with 150 Vac and does not trip with 132 Vac
